Located in the province of San Luis (central Argentina) and operated exclusively by Paco Riestra, El Durazno Lodge is the largest free range in Argentina and South America, with an impressive number of red stags, buffalos, and black bucks. No high fence at all: superb 65,000 hectares of open hunting land, only Africa and Australia can match this conditions and size.

The red stag was introduced in 1906, and today we find an estimated population of more than 5000 red stags (and over 600 water buffalos).

The lodge is strategically located in the center of the estate, which allows us to cut down as much land as possible. Our small and charming lodge is set on a magical spot, with a beautiful garden and large lake in front of the house to relax after the hunting day.
